Dear Zoners,
on some Beatles pages I read about the anomalies in Beatles songs. Now I wonder if you found anomalies in Queen songs.
For example, on Bring back that Leroy Brown there are two snare drums used. That's one I found. Errors and glitches count as anomalies, too.

thanks, yes, I know that too, that'S about metric anomalies. I thought of the anomalies like f.e. the cowbell on Night comes down changes its pitch after 3 bars. Or the tape phaser effect on Liars drum intro.

Queen songs with two pianos:
- Nevermore (one of them effected)
- Black Queen
- Leroy Brown
- Save Me
Two+ Basses (even if they`re synth+human):
- Leroy Brown (bass + double bass)
- Love Of My Life
- Fun It
- Dragon Attack
- Football Fight
- Machines
- Radio Ga Ga
- A Kind Of Magic (Highlander version, I`m not sure)
- Pain Is So Close
- Miracle
- Invisible Man
- Breakthru
- Ride The Wild Wind
- I Was Born To Love You
